Embracing Functionality

Embracing FunctionalityAs we look towards the year 2024, the world of interior design is undergoing a significant shift towards minimalism with a strong emphasis on functionality. Designers are now prioritizing essential elements that not only look great but also serve a practical purpose. This approach is all about making the most of the available space by adopting a “less is more” philosophy.

Furniture that comes with built-in storage, convertible pieces, and modular solutions are growing in popularity, providing homeowners with versatile options that can be easily adapted to their changing needs. By blending form and function, minimalist design is transforming living spaces into practical yet stylish havens that cater to the needs of modern homeowners.

Sustainable Minimalism

Sustainable MinimalismSustainability has become a pressing issue in our society, and it has touched every aspect of our lives, including the way we design our interior spaces. In the year 2024, minimalist spaces are at the forefront of eco-friendliness, as designers are integrating sustainable materials and practices into their designs.

They are seamlessly incorporating environmentally conscious elements into minimalist aesthetics, such as the use of reclaimed wood furniture, energy-efficient lighting, and other eco-friendly items. These elements not only promote sustainability, but also add texture, warmth, and personality to the space, creating a unique and inviting atmosphere.

Technological Integration

Technological IntegrationIn recent years, there have been significant advancements in technology that have opened up new possibilities for minimalist interior design. With the integration of smart home features, hidden wiring, and home automation systems, it is now possible to create a modern and minimalist living space that is both functional and aesthetically pleasing.

These features are seamlessly incorporated into minimalistic spaces, making them almost invisible to the eye. The ultimate objective is to maintain a clean and uncluttered look while maximizing the convenience and efficiency of modern technology. This results in a space that is not only visually appealing but also highly functional, making it the perfect place to relax and unwind after a long day.

Natural Elements and Biophilic Design

Natural Elements and Biophilic DesignIn line with the current trend, the concept of bringing the beauty of the outdoors inside is expected to gain more popularity. The usage of natural elements such as indoor plants, stone accents, and large windows in minimalist designs has become a common practice to create a harmonious blend of nature and architecture.

The principles of biophilic design, which aim to bring the occupants closer to nature, are now being incorporated into minimalist designs. These principles not only enhance the overall well-being of the occupants but also promote a sense of tranquility within the minimalist environment.

Monochromatic Palettes

Monochromatic PalettesIn the world of interior design, minimalism has been a long-standing trend, characterized by a preference for neutral color schemes that offer a subdued, understated look. However, a new direction is emerging, and monochromatic palettes are taking center stage.

Designers are now exploring the depth and versatility of individual color tones, creating visually stunning interiors that rely on subtle variations in hue and texture to add interest and depth without overburdening the space with clutter. The result is an aesthetic that is both modern and minimalist, yet rich in visual appeal, offering a sense of balance that soothes the mind and delights the eye.

Textural Exploration

Textural ExplorationMinimalist interiors are becoming increasingly popular among homeowners for their clean, uncluttered look. However, to make these spaces more visually appealing and engaging, designers are experimenting with various textures. They’re exploring the use of luxurious fabrics, textured wall treatments, and other tactile elements to add depth and interest.

The interplay of different textures creates a sense of richness that complements the simplicity of the design, making these spaces even more inviting and comfortable.
